Which HTML tag is used for the largest heading?

Explanation:
The tag used for the largest heading in HTML is the `<h1>` tag. This tag signifies the most important heading on a webpage, and it is typically used for the main title or a key section title. Browsers often render this tag in a larger and bolder font compared to other heading tags, such as `<h2>` and `<h3>`, making it visually prominent. Using heading tags correctly is important for structure, accessibility, and SEO (Search Engine Optimization). The correct use of headings allows search engines to better understand the content of the page and can improve a site's search ranking. The `<div>` tag, on the other hand, is a general-purpose container that does not have semantic meaning related to headings, which is why it doesn't serve the same function as the heading tags.
